I think there was also a picture of the bagging> platform, but it's been a LONG time.  The wheels aren't duals, there is> a 2nd axle stub just in front or behind of the original and the 2nd> wheel tracks offset both to the side and fore/aft of the main wheel.> Duals would still drop into a ditch or cultivator ridge, the tandems> were almost like having a 2' track on each side, one would carry the> other over a small gully.
